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

Echo Yin

1
Posts
7
Followers
21
Following
A member registered Nov 29, 2020 · View creator page →

Creator of

Recent community posts

(1 edit)

Thank you for your time and dedication writing a constructive feedback! We strive to improve as we are learning 💕